Transaction 2680199fc139c307b8e615eb39d16a6a4958ff84a2d9c14ffc9acbe196aeff25

3 Input
2 Outputs
  • 2680199fc139c307b8e615eb39d16a6a4958ff84a2d9c14ffc9acbe196aeff25:0
  • value  68664
    address  bc1qerun059lz53dp35swdz8kr2ngep5mnz4q7vxs3
  • 2680199fc139c307b8e615eb39d16a6a4958ff84a2d9c14ffc9acbe196aeff25:1
  • value  1148604
    address  327it3igTC3hA7MK2wmjN7ohsmdEmxbfBA